It wasn’t worries over new COVID-19 outbreaks in China or growing concern of investors about the recession, but a report of low levels of diesel inventory ahead of winter that triggered buying on Thursday, prompting a 2% gain for crude oil prices.
The gains came after 3 consecutive days of losses.
West Texas Intermediate crude for November delivery rose $1.97 or 2.2% to close at $89.24 on the New York Mercantile Exchange.
Global benchmark Brent crude for December delivery went up $2.23 or 2.4% to finish the day at $94.68 a barrel on ICE Futures Europe.
November natural gas rose 28 cents or 4.2% to settle at $6.71 per MMBtu.
Crude oil prices initially moved lower in early trading on Thursday as the Energy Information Administration reported an increase of 9.9 million barrels of crude oil for the week to Oct. 7. Soon, prices started rising.
Finally, Oklahoma energy stocks saw a turnaround in trading on Thursday with gains as much as 7% by Matrix Service, 6% by Mammoth Energy, and 5% by PHX Minerals.
